"Ephemeral Earth" is a participative performance questioning the fragile balance of our habitat. Participate in the destruction of a raw clay shelter patiently built by the ceramists of the GADOUE collective. A performance proposed by Etienne Dubernet, Lara Erel and Virginie Pommel aka Elpom.

A clay shelter of 300 kg was built by three ceramists of the GADOUE collective in a room of the workshop. A protective shelter in which visitors can, if they wish, enter. A body, a house that gives off an apparent solidity linked to its imposing structure. Yet its balance is based on a subtle harmony. A sensitive experience is offered to the spectators.

After having familiarized themselves with this environment, at 7:19 pm, the visitors are invited to participate in the performance "Ephemeral Earth". They point out the structural parts of the raw earth shelter that the collective will cut, weakening it until it collapses. The visitors are confronted with the tipping point, the one that will break the balance. Metaphor and manifesto of our fragility when we do not take care of our protective place.

At the same time, an accelerated video of the construction of the shelter will be shown. It is a testimony of a collective work over a long time as opposed to the rapid destruction of the shelter.

GADOUE is a collective workshop of ceramists in Lyon Guillotière since February 2022. It is a place of fabrication, creation and experimentation around the clay material. Used to firing their ceramics to make them last in time, the ceramists of the collective experiment a new way with a collective performance in raw clay.
